WebDoctrine of double effect is a great bioethics topic that applies to palliative care. It explains why, in the trolley experiment, why it's ok to pull the lever but not ok to push the fat man off the bridge. If the doctrine of double effect is true, then it's a strike against utilitarianism. It's compatible with Kantianism though.
WebAbout the FBN. Founded 31 years ago, the Florida Bioethics Network is one of the oldest and largest bioethics networks in the country. It is committed to education and to identifying practical solutions to daily challenges faced by Florida hospitals, hospices, and nursing homes.
